Bible Verses About Moving To A New Place

Here are 50 powerful Bible verses to guide, comfort, and inspire you as you move to a new place:

Genesis 12:1 “Go from your country, your people and your father’s household to the land I will show you.”

Joshua 1:9 “Be strong and courageous… for the Lord your God will be with you wherever you go.”

Proverbs 3:5–6 “Trust in the Lord with all your heart… and He will make your paths straight.”

Psalm 121:8 “The Lord will watch over your coming and going both now and forevermore.”

Isaiah 41:10 “Do not fear, for I am with you… I will uphold you with my righteous right hand.”

Psalm 32:8 “I will instruct you and teach you in the way you should go.”

Deuteronomy 31:8 “The Lord himself goes before you and will be with you.”

Hebrews 13:5 “Never will I leave you; never will I forsake you.”

Psalm 37:23 “The Lord makes firm the steps of the one who delights in Him.”

Jeremiah 29:11 “For I know the plans I have for you… plans to give you hope and a future.”

Exodus 33:14 “My Presence will go with you, and I will give you rest.”

Psalm 46:1 “God is our refuge and strength, an ever-present help in trouble.”

Isaiah 43:2 “When you pass through the waters, I will be with you.”

Matthew 28:20 “I am with you always, to the very end of the age.”

Psalm 139:9–10 “If I rise on the wings of the dawn… even there your hand will guide me.”

Proverbs 16:9 “In their hearts humans plan their course, but the Lord establishes their steps.”

Psalm 23:1 “The Lord is my shepherd, I lack nothing.”

Isaiah 30:21 “Whether you turn to the right or to the left, your ears will hear a voice… saying, ‘This is the way.’”

Romans 8:28 “In all things God works for the good of those who love Him.”

Psalm 90:17 “May the favor of the Lord our God rest on us.”

James 1:5 “If any of you lacks wisdom, you should ask God.”

Psalm 27:1 “The Lord is my light and my salvation—whom shall I fear?”

Isaiah 26:3 “You will keep in perfect peace those whose minds are steadfast.”

Psalm 84:11 “No good thing does He withhold from those whose walk is blameless.”

2 Corinthians 5:7 “For we live by faith, not by sight.”

Psalm 125:1 “Those who trust in the Lord are like Mount Zion.”

Isaiah 58:11 “The Lord will guide you always.”

Philippians 4:6–7 “Do not be anxious about anything… and the peace of God will guard your hearts.”

Psalm 34:10 “Those who seek the Lord lack no good thing.”

Ecclesiastes 3:1 “There is a time for everything, and a season for every activity.”

Psalm 55:22 “Cast your cares on the Lord and He will sustain you.”

Isaiah 40:31 “Those who hope in the Lord will renew their strength.”

Psalm 20:4 “May He give you the desire of your heart.”

Lamentations 3:22–23 “His mercies never come to an end; they are new every morning.”

John 14:27 “Peace I leave with you; my peace I give you.”

Psalm 31:24 “Be strong and take heart, all you who hope in the Lord.”

Romans 15:13 “May the God of hope fill you with all joy and peace.”

Psalm 16:11 “You make known to me the path of life.”

Isaiah 55:12 “You will go out in joy and be led forth in peace.”

Psalm 37:5 “Commit your way to the Lord; trust in Him.”

1 Peter 5:7 “Cast all your anxiety on Him because He cares for you.”

Psalm 119:105 “Your word is a lamp for my feet.”

Matthew 6:33 “Seek first His kingdom and His righteousness.”

Psalm 18:2 “The Lord is my rock, my fortress and my deliverer.”

Isaiah 12:2 “Surely God is my salvation; I will trust and not be afraid.”

Psalm 9:9 “The Lord is a refuge for the oppressed.”

Hebrews 11:8 “By faith Abraham… obeyed and went, even though he did not know where he was going.”

Psalm 28:7 “The Lord is my strength and my shield.”

Isaiah 33:2 “Be our strength every morning.”

Psalm 121:1–2 “My help comes from the Lord, the Maker of heaven and earth.”

Our Thoughts On What the Bible Says About Moving to a New Place

Moving to a new place, according to the Bible, is often part of God’s divine plan rather than just a personal decision. Scripture shows that God sometimes calls people to step out of their comfort zones, just as He did with Abraham, to lead them into something greater. Even when the path is unclear, the Bible encourages believers to trust that God is guiding their steps and working behind the scenes for their good.

At the same time, the Bible reminds us that God’s presence is not tied to a specific location. No matter where you go, He goes with you, offering peace, strength, and direction. Moving can feel uncertain, but it also creates an opportunity to grow in faith, rely more on God, and embrace new beginnings with confidence, knowing He is already there ahead of you.

FAQ’s

Does the Bible support moving to a new place?

Yes, the Bible shows many examples of people moving as part of God’s plan. It often represents growth, purpose, and new beginnings guided by Him.

How can I trust God when moving feels uncertain?

Trust grows through prayer and relying on His promises. The Bible reminds us that God is always with us and directing our path.

What does the Bible say about fear during relocation?

Scripture repeatedly says “do not fear” because God is present. He gives strength and peace even in unfamiliar situations.

Can moving strengthen my faith?

Yes, moving can push you to depend more on God. It often becomes a time of spiritual growth and deeper trust in Him.

How should I pray when moving to a new place?

Pray for guidance, protection, and peace in your new journey. Ask God to lead you, provide for you, and help you settle with confidence.
